NOVELTY - Graphene reinforced aluminum-based material preparation involves providing modified graphene comprising a graphene body and a modified material attached to the surface of the graphene body, where the modified material is titanium carbide, boron carbide, tungsten carbide, zirconium carbide and silicon carbide. The base material, the reinforcing agent and the modified graphene are mixed and then subjected to forming treatment to obtain a graphene-reinforced aluminum-based material. The reinforcing agent is selected from alloys of copper, magnesium and zinc, or carbon nanotubes. USE - Method for preparing graphene reinforced aluminum-based material used in aluminum alloy component for compressor (all claimed). ADVANTAGE - The method prepares the graphene reinforced aluminum-based material in a simple, cost-effective and eco-friendly manner with improved strength and wear resistance.
